Weekday construction from Clints Well to Mormon Lake Village for next 6 months - January 2014 through June 2014
This may affect those visiting the various trailheads in the upper West Clear Creek drainage this spring and early summer as well as where the AZT crosses the highway (jct of #29 Happy Jack and #30 Mormon Lake.)A safety project to provide a clear zone on each side of Lake Mary Road has begun. Arizona Department of Transportation is administering a project to thin trees on Lake Mary Road starting from Clint’s Well to just south of Mormon Lake Road. The project is a total of 27 miles between mileposts 290 and 317 on both sides of the highway. Work will be during daylight hours Monday through Friday, and is anticipated to last approximately 6 months. Workers MAY have to close the road at times if they feel the trees they are felling pose a danger to highway motorists. Most of the tree removal will be chipped, and merchantable trees will be decked and hauled off. Please proceed with caution and obey all traffic signs.
